There are a number of processes involved in mold remediation procedures. The first step in addressing any indoor mold problem is diminishing the source of moisture. The second step is mold removal. To remedy minor mold problems, people can resort to the following: exposure to the sun, ventilation and household cleansers. The use of non-porous building materials is also a good option. For major mold situations, contacting a professional is the only choice. Mold cleanup not only involves the elimination of the mold but also the removal of the contaminated objects. Mold can be removed through dry ice freeze blasting, dry fog, damp wipe and HEPA vacuum. Before anything can be done, however, the structure should undergo mold testing first.
